What is a Sinovo PLC Controller?

A Sinovo PLC (Programmable Logic Controller) is a type of industrial computer that is designed to automate and control industrial processes. It is a core component of industrial automation systems, allowing factory equipment to perform tasks efficiently and reliably.

How to Apply the XD3-48T-E PLC Controller in Industrial Automation Systems?

1、Identify the industrial processes that need to be automated and controlled. This includes tasks such as machine operation, conveyor belt movement, and lighting control.

2、Design a program using the programming language of your choice (e.g., ladder logic or relay logic) to automate these processes. The program should specify the sequence of operations, conditions for triggering actions, and any necessary data monitoring or recording.

3、Load the program into the XD3-48T-E PLC controller using a suitable programming tool or software application. Ensure that the program is properly tested and validated before deployment in a production environment.

4、Connect the XD3-48T-E PLC controller to the factory equipment that needs to be controlled. This may involve connecting to sensors, actuators, or other industrial devices using appropriate cables or interfaces.

5、Monitor and maintain the industrial automation system regularly to ensure that it is operating efficiently and reliably. This includes checking the status of the XD3-48T-E PLC controller, reviewing program logs, and addressing any issues or concerns that arise during operation.
